I know this is a family forum so I'll chose my words carefully

Having worked with service dogs for many years, many of whom seemed to track and find skunks better than missing people... I found that douche works the best to get the smell out. I would keep unscented massengil(spelling) around the house at all times! The clerk always gave me a funny look when I (being male) came through the checkout line with 4-5 containers

Be careful with Febreeze around aquariums!!!!! You can wipe out your tank with that stuff.

There are products on the market for skunk stuff - I realize I'm 5 days late into this thread - but that smell can remain for what seems like forever.

Back home we had a litter of baby skunks that was orphaned. That was an adventure - we gave them wet cat food on pie plates to wean them - and eventually they left and went on their merry way, EXCEPT the one that my dog found, killed (after it sprayed) and rolled in it. 30 minutes before I had my service club group arrive for a dinner party

You can probably buy it anywhere now, but at the time I could only get it at a vet's - "Skunk Off"

http://www.healthypets.com/skunbythorco.html

It worked wonders. In fact a few years ago I was at a trade show and saw a booth with the stuff, and I stood there telling people how wonderful it was - the guy gave me a bunch of free bottles! We don't have many skunks around here so it hasn't been an issue - but back home skunks were *everywhere*.

I have also used Skunk'd shampoo on the dog

http://www.dogodor.com/catalog_c54427.html

That worked well too but I didn't like the smell of the shampoo either!

I had both things on hand back home, and not too long after the killed skunk incident, the dog came bounding home with her face dripping wet... yep, sprayed right in the kisser. We had a big property that she had free run of - and she'd find the darndest things... anyway, the Skunk Off worked wonders again.

I think the "active ingredient" in tomato juice is citric acid. Both those products I mentioned have a lot of citrus in them - I guess the acid cuts the stench.

If things are still smelling kinda high - give those products a try
